The ACNC Commissioner has just released the ACNC’s Interpretation Statement on Public Benevolent Institutions. The Interpretation Statement provides guidance on the ACNC’s interpretation of the law pertaining to Public Benevolent Institutions (PBI) and insight into how the ACNC and its staff will assess a charitable organisation’s entitlement for endorsement as a PBI. Last week, the ACNC launched a “Registered Charity Tick”. The tick may be used by charities registered on the ACNC Charity Register which are up to date with ACNC financial reporting requirements and meet the regulator’s governance standards. The tick will allow donors to easily identify registered charitable organisations complying with these requirements.
